I saw some pix of an old Nymph with the logo on the back of the seats. I even looked for n.o.s. seats. Obviously to no avail........
My buddy makes commercial awnings and they do appliques all the time. I took a pic of the logo on the console and, his graphix guy downsized it, matched color, and made decals for me. My seats have very deep grain in the vinyl so, he gave me a very short, very stiff brush to force the vinyl into the vinyl.



And by the way guys, I wanted new seat mounts, etc. I got on Springfield's website, to decide what kind to get. I saw a scratch and dent area. Bought stainless 7x7 bases, posts, and seat mounts for 26 dollars per set. I can't find the blemish! Something to consider..........

Actually............Yes.
Splashed yesterday. Cold, windy, rainy. But, I could not be more pleased with the boat!
Drafts about 5 inches higher in the stern, even with the new rear deck, additional battery, etc.
The boat never really wanted to get up and go last year. Now, with three people on board, it gets on plane very quickly. I was amazed.
this is a 35 hp boat!
Fished a little today and, love the setup so far. I'll keep you guys posted!
